Rhipidomys couesi: Comments
Comment:
Status: IUCN - Lower Risk (lc)
Comment:
Comments: R. leucodactylus section sensu Tribe (1996). Cabrera (1961) identified couesi as a subspecies of R. sclateri. As emphasized by its original describer Thomas (1887b), sclateri closely resembles Peruvian R. leucodactylus, and, in both Venezuela (see Handley, 1976) and Perú, R. couesi and R. leucodactylus are morphologically distinct
